Originally Posted by Ducky
I have a question about Retayne. Is it only used to wash the completed quilt? I wouldn't use it to prewash, right?
Ducky, I use the Retayne to prewash fabric that bleed to fix the dye, that is what the instructions on the bottle say to do. I wouldn't use it on a finished quilt, because if the fabrics bled, it may fix it in the wrong fabric :shock:

I do throw in a color catcher or two with the completed quilt wash to make sure it absorbs any extra dye. Does that maw sense?
